We hope you will build happiness with Gradle, and we look forward to your feedback via [Twitter](https://twitter.com/gradle) or on [GitHub](https://redirect.github.com/gradle). ### [`v8.11.1`](https://redirect.github.com/gradle/gradle/releases/tag/v8.11.1): 8.11.1 [Compare Source](https://redirect.github.com/gradle/gradle/compare/v8.11.0...v8.11.1) This is a patch release for Gradle 8.11. We recommend users upgrade to 8.11.1 instead of 8.11. It fixes the following issues: - [#​31268](https://redirect.github.com/gradle/gradle/issues/31268) BuildEventsListenerRegistry corrupted with Isolated Projects and parallel configuration - [#​31282](https://redirect.github.com/gradle/gradle/issues/31282) Running executables sporadically fails with ETXTBSY (Text file busy) - [#​31284](https://redirect.github.com/gradle/gradle/issues/31284) ArrayIndexOutOfBoundsException after upgrading to gradle 8.11 when generating problems report - [#​31310](https://redirect.github.com/gradle/gradle/issues/31310) Unable to run Gradle task in 8.10 due to bytecode interception [Read the Release Notes](https://docs.gradle.org/8.11.1/release-notes.html) ##### Upgrade instructions Switch your build to use Gradle 8.11.1 by updating your wrapper: ``` ./gradlew wrapper --gradle-version=8.11.1 ``` See the Gradle [8.x upgrade guide](https://docs.gradle.org/8.11.1/userguide/upgrading_version_8.html) to learn about deprecations, breaking changes and other considerations when upgrading.
